Menachot 63 -Fried and Baked Flour Offerings
Beit Shammai are not certain if "deep" refers to the pan or to the offering, so according to them one who promises a deep-pan offering (not an offering in a deep pan) has to wait until Elijah the Prophet comes and explains how to do it.
The oven-baked flour offering can be either loaves baked with oil or wafers baked without oil and smeared with oil after baking. It was baked in a stove called "tanur," which had a trapezoidal shape with an opening at the top. Bread was baked by affixing it to the walls of the oven.
